'Party Hard 2' Christmas Alpha free download now available

Game developer Pinokl has recently released an alpha build of "Party Hard 2" for free download.

For those who do not know, imagine this: a younger, pre "Metal Gear" Big Boss just called it a night, then went straight to bed to try and get his much-needed rest. However, this loud, party-loving neighbors and their friends kept jolting him awake in the middle of the night with their loud music and drunken revelry.

So, what does Big Boss do, being the responsible citizen that he is? He takes a knife then proceeds to kill everyone in sight either by slashing them or blowing them up.

That's the type of extreme mayhem that "Party Hard" offers — minus Big Boss.

Pinokl's stealth-based 2D strategy game was released in 2015. While the game offers little in graphics compared to this generation's more visually appealing titles, it offers twice the fun with its challenging yet enjoyable gameplay, complete with an 80's style retro beat that players would bob their heads to while thinking of clever ways to wipe everybody out.

The Christmas Alpha version of "Party Hard 2" allows the players to control a disgruntled employee who did not receive his Christmas bonus and decided to take out his frustrations on his co-workers during the office party.

In the game, the player must stealthily make his way around the partying crowd, using his knife or several objects in the environment to eliminate his targets.

The player also has to be careful not to be spotted or leave around too many clues, such as leaving dead bodies out in the open as it would cause the crowd to panic and call the police.

The game's publisher, Tinybuild, recently posted in the steam community forums that the development team had to "go back to the drawing board and redesign key parts of the game."

Some of these newer features are included in the Alpha, which the developers purposely allowed to be downloaded for free in order to receive feedback from the gaming community.
